What are learning walks? 

Learning walks and talks are when a group of teachers visit multiple classrooms at their own school with the aim of fostering conversation about teaching and learning to develop a shared vision of high-quality teaching that impacts on student learning.  

 

Learning walks help identify agreed areas of professional learning for the school, create opportunities for conversations with students and teachers about their learning, build relationships, identify agreed practices, help monitor students’ learning progress and are evidence towards achieving AIP goals.
